Initial Recovery Phase
Immediately following the NeoGraft procedure, patients may experience mild discomfort, swelling, and redness, which are normal reactions to the treatment. Typically, these symptoms subside within a few days. Patients are advised to rest and avoid strenuous activities for the first 24 to 48 hours to ensure proper healing. Applying a cold compress can help reduce swelling and discomfort during this initial phase.
Post-Operative Care
Proper post-operative care is essential for a smooth recovery. Patients are usually given specific instructions by their healthcare provider, which may include washing the hair gently, avoiding tight hairstyles, and refraining from using harsh chemicals or products on the scalp. It is important to follow these guidelines to prevent infection and promote healthy hair growth.
Physical Activity Restrictions
Patients are generally advised to avoid heavy lifting, vigorous exercise, and any activity that may cause excessive sweating for at least the first week after the procedure. This restriction is crucial as it helps prevent trauma to the newly transplanted hair follicles and reduces the risk of complications. Gradual reintroduction to physical activities can be discussed with the healthcare provider based on individual recovery progress.
Hair Growth and Follow-Up
The NeoGraft procedure involves the transplantation of hair follicles, which will initially fall out before new growth begins. This phase, known as the "shock loss" period, typically lasts for a few weeks. New hair growth becomes noticeable around three to four months post-procedure, with full results visible after about one year. Regular follow-up appointments with the healthcare provider are essential to monitor progress and address any concerns.

Q: How long does the NeoGraft procedure take?
A: The procedure typically takes between 4 to 8 hours, depending on the extent of the hair transplant required.
Q: Is the NeoGraft procedure painful?
A: The procedure is performed under local anesthesia, so patients experience minimal pain during the treatment. Post-operative discomfort is usually manageable with prescribed medications.
Q: When can I return to work after the NeoGraft procedure?
A: Most patients can return to work within a few days, depending on their job requirements and the level of activity involved.
Q: Are there any long-term side effects of the NeoGraft procedure?
A: The NeoGraft procedure is generally safe with minimal long-term side effects. However, as with any medical procedure, there is a small risk of infection or other complications, which are typically managed by the healthcare provider.
